If you go to Bhagal Kammagondanahalli, you’ll find us there. Lal Telecom isn't a big store. It’s basically one long room with a counter running down the side. We have cables hanging from the walls and rows of phone cases that have been there for months. The air is always a bit stuffy because the small window doesn't open all the way. We spend most of the day hunched over small tables, looking at tiny screws and circuit boards. It’s quiet work, except for when the radio is on. We listen to the local stations while we work on phones. A lot of people come in just to ask for directions or to get a quick recharge done. The floor is covered in bits of plastic and wire clippings that we sweep up at the very end of the night. It’s not the cleanest place, but we know where everything is. The sign outside is a bit faded from the sun, but people know it’s Lal Telecom. Sometimes the neighborhood kids hang out near the front for the shade. We don't mind. It’s a decent place to work and the neighbors are alright. We don't have any big plans to change things, we just keep doing what we do every day since we opened up here in Bhagal. It’s a simple living for us, and we are happy to stay in this neighborhood.
